R. Kelly appeared in court in Chicago Tuesday for a hearing on the state sex-crime charges against him. One person R. Kelly Friend Valencia Love wants her money back, but Judge Flood says she will lose the bail money since he was charged federally and landed in federal jail. – USAToday

Here is what is going on with R. Kelly’s Friend Loses Bail Money.

The judge says papers that R. Kelly’s friend Valencia Love signed clearly indicated she could lose the money.

Apparently, that is exactly what is happening. She paid his bail back in February to secure the singer’s release from the county jail.

Now, Love’s lawyer John Collins said in court Tuesday that she didn’t know when she paid 10% of a $1 million bond that Kelly would be charged federally and land in federal jail.

Collins said Love now fears to lose all the money as charges against Kelly stack up.

Basically, Love is now learning the hard way, sometimes you don’t put up money for someone that is in serious trouble with the law. Now, she is out $100,000 in bail according to Judge Lawrence Flood read sections of papers Love signed warning the bond money could be used for Kelly’s legal fees.
